About This Landmark

Wayne National Forest, located in the scenic region of southern Ohio, offers a refreshing escape into nature's tranquil beauty. Spanning more than a quarter-million acres, this forest is a lush mosaic of rolling hills, verdant woodlands, and sparkling waters, making it an ideal destination for outdoor enthusiasts. Its diverse landscapes provide a glimpse into Ohio's rich natural heritage, featuring unique rock formations and abundant wildlife. One of the standout features is the picturesque Lake Vesuvius, surrounded by towering trees and rocky bluffs, offering breathtaking views and a peaceful ambiance.

The forest is home to rare plant species and a variety of animal habitats, making it a vital ecological area. A part of the forest's allure lies in its intricate network of trails, which winds through diverse terrains, providing both leisurely walks and challenging hikes. Adventure Guide to Wayne National Forest

Hiking Trails around Lake Vesuvius

  • Specialty: Offers a variety of trails ranging from easy to challenging, with stunning views of the lake and surrounding forest.
  • Key Features: The Vesuvius Backpack Trail provides a loop around the lake, showcasing beautiful scenery and diverse plant life.
  • Local Insights: Look out for the sandstone formations and spring wildflowers.
  • Visitor Tips: Best visited in spring or fall when the foliage is most vibrant. Pack water, snacks, and a map of trail routes.

Fishing at Symmes Creek

  • Specialty: Freshwater creek offering excellent fishing opportunities for bass and catfish.
  • Key Features: Quiet and secluded spots ideal for a relaxing fishing experience.
  • Local Insights: Obtain a fishing license beforehand, and check local regulations on catch limits.
  • Visitor Tips: Early morning or late afternoon are prime times. Bring your fishing gear and wear comfortable, waterproof boots.

ATV Trails in Hanging Rock

  • Specialty: Over 26 miles of trails designed for off-road enthusiasts.
  • Key Features: Varied terrains with pathways through dense forest and open areas.
  • Local Insights: Comply with all safety regulations and have appropriate permits.
  • Visitor Tips: Recommended during drier months. Wear safety gear and inform someone about your itinerary.

Driving Directions: From Ironton, OH, take OH-93 North for about 15 miles to reach the forest entrance, approximately a 25-minute drive.
